Christine Netski to speak at 2016 MassDLA – MATA event on: “Both Sides of the Bar” |
Date: March 3, 2016 |

Partner Christine M. Netski will join a panel at the 2016 MassDLA – MATA Joint Education & Networking Event, “Both Sides of the Bar.” The program brings together the plaintiffs organization, MATA, and defense organization, MassDLA, to present good, practical advocacy advice, and creative trial strategies. The panel will consist of four speakers from each side of the bar, who will give their views on trial techniques, anecdotes, and tips to learn from. The program will be held on Thursday, March 3 from 5:30 PM to 8:00 PM at the Hyatt Regency Boston (One Avenue De LaFayette, Boston, MA).
